✦ Synopsis


In this riveting tale of psychological suspense, a divorce lawyer risks her career, her sanity, and her life when she falls into an illicit, all-consuming affair with her client--who becomes the primary suspect in his estranged wife's sudden disappearance.

Young divorce lawyer Francine Day has methodically built her career doing everything right. She's one big case away from securing her place among London's legal elite. But when she meets her new client, Martin Joy, the natural caution that has protected Francine and fueled her rise melts away. Powerless to fight the irresistible magnetism between them, client and counsel tumble into a blistering affair that breaks every rule.
